WebApr 10, 2024 · Endive (Cichorium endivia): Endive adds a peppery/bitter flavor and grows well with leaf lettuce in a container garden. Sorrel (Rumex acestosa): If you like a tart, lemony flavor, sorrel is a perfect addition to a mesclun mix. WebWild Lettuce. Wild lettuce is a common weed. It can be called prickly lettuce, tall lettuce, or bitter lettuce. It is related to garden lettuce, but it has a sharp flavor. It is also known … WebWild lettuce secretes a milky white ingredient known as lactucarium when it is scratched or cut.
